Horizon Therapeutics plc agreed on February 1, 2021 to acquire Viela Bio, Inc. for $53.00 per share in cash, a fully diluted equity value of approximately $3.05 billion (about $2.67 billion net of Viela's cash and equivalents). The deal closed March 15, 2021 via tender offer and merger after holders of ~94% of shares tendered. Viela, a 2018 MedImmune/AstraZeneca spinout, brought Horizon its first approved autoimmune medicine, Uplizna (inebilizumab) for neuromyelitis optica spectrum disorder (NMOSD), plus a clinical pipeline (VIB7734/daxdilimab, VIB4920/dazodalibep) and a Uplizna expansion program in myasthenia gravis. AstraZeneca, holding ~26.7% of Viela, netted roughly $760-780 million. Horizon itself was later acquired by Amgen, which completed its ~$27.8 billion purchase on October 6, 2023, folding Uplizna into Amgen's rare-disease portfolio.
